What Does Salt Represent On An Ofrenda . It is believed that during the journey of the afterlife, the salt will prevent the body of the departed from breaking down as it travels along the winding road to eternity. In many cultures, salt is seen as a protective or purifying element. Candles and lights, which represent guides to help souls escape from purgatory.
